| Description | SD-1077, also known as d3-L-DOPA, is a deuterium containing levodopa. SD-1077 has been shown in preclinical models to improve the half-life of dopamine in the brain resulting in a prolonged treatment effect. |
| Synonyms | d3-L-DOPA, deuldopa, deuterated levodopa, SD1077 |
